Fertige Seite kopieren und in Xampp Lokal ans laufen bringen
am 07.04.2016 - 06:45 Uhr in
Hallo,
ich versuche nun seit mehreren Tagen mein Drupal 7 Projekt vom Webserver auf meinem Lokalen Rechner an laufen zu bringen.
Die Xmpp Umgebung habe ich soweit angepasst.
Nun zum Problem.
Eine leere Drupal installation lokal funktioniert einwandfrei.
Meine Kopie vom Webserver hingegen bekomme ich einfach nicht gestartet.
Datenbank vom Server gesichert.
Alle Dateien von Drupal per FTP gesichert.
Datenbank lokal importiert, fehlerfrei nach einigen Änderungen in den ini's
Dateien nach htdocs/Drupal kopiert
localhost/Drupal augerufen und dann komme ich einfach nicht weiter, folgende Meldung bekomme ich.
PDOException: SQLSTATE[42S02]: Base table or view not found: 1146 Table 'db530500940.zog7cus11semaphore' doesn't exist: SELECT expire, value FROM {semaphore} WHERE name = :name; Array ( [:name] => variable_init ) in lock_may_be_available() (line 167 of C:\xampp\htdocs\Drupal\includes\lock.inc).
Laut google soll angeblich der Eintrag semaphore nicht da sein, ist er aber.
Ich habe beide Datenbanken also die von der leeren funktionierenden Installation angeschaut was genau da unter semaphore eingetragen ist und verglichen mit meiner importierten Datenbank vom Webserver.
Bei beiden sind die gleichen Werte eingetragen und trotzdem bekomme ich die Meldung.
Hier der Auschnitt der settings.php zur Datenbank
$databases = array (
'default' =>
array (
'default' =>
array (
'database' => 'db530500940',
'username' => 'xxxxxxx',
'password' => 'xxxxxxx',
'host' => 'localhost',
'port' => '',
'driver' => 'mysql',
'prefix' => 'zog7cus11',
Was mache ich blos noch falsch?
Gruß Udo
Ich habe einen Fehler gefunden.
beim Präfix habe ich am Ende einen _ vergessen.
'prefix' => 'zog7cus11_',
Dann kommt aber eine neue Fehlermeldung.
Fatal error: require_once(): Failed opening required 'C:\xampp\htdocs\Drupal/sites/all/modules/mimemail/includes/mimemail.mail.inc' (include_path='C:\xampp\php\PEAR') in C:\xampp\htdocs\Drupal\includes\bootstrap.inc on line 3139
- Anmelden oder Registrieren um Kommentare zu schreiben
Hi,den ersten Fehler hast Du
am 07.04.2016 - 08:27 Uhr
Hi,
den ersten Fehler hast Du ja schon gefunden.
PDOException: SQLSTATE[42S02]: Base table or view not found: 1146 Table 'db530500940.zog7cus11semaphore'
db530500940.zog7cus11_semaphore
Beim anderen ist die Datei wohl nicht richtig runtergeladen worden:
Fatal error: require_once(): Failed opening required 'C:\xampp\htdocs\Drupal/sites/all/modules/mimemail/includes/mimemail.mail.inc'
Ist bei Dir in XAMPP dieses File vorhanden?
C:\xampp\htdocs\Drupal/sites/all/modules/mimemail/includes/mimemail.mail.inc
Gruss
Robert
PS;
Da stimmt auch was mit Deinen Slashes nicht!
C:\xampp\htdocs\Drupal/sites/all/modules/mimemail/includes/mimemail.mail.inc
da hast du fehler beim
am 07.04.2016 - 08:33 Uhr
da hast du fehler beim kopieren der datenbank und der dateien gemacht...
Fehler beim kopieren
am 07.04.2016 - 09:40 Uhr
Hallo caw,
wie meinst du das, ich habe Fehler beim kopieren gemacht?
Die Datenbank habe ich einmal mit Myphp gesichert und einmal mit dumper, in beiden Fällen komme ich nicht weiter.
Die Dateien vom Webserver habe ich mit Filezilla runtergeladen, was kann ich da Falsch machen?
Das mit den Slashes finde ich in der Tat sehr mehrwürdig, aber wie kann ich das beeinflussen.
Mhhh..????
Ich werde noch einmal alles mit Filezilla runter laden und nach htdocs kopieren und gucken was dann passiert.
Danke erst einmal für Eure Antworten.
Es liest sich im Netz so einfach die Seite lokal laufen zu lassen, das ich das dann einfach nicht hinbekomme nervt mich schon arg.
Gruß Udo
Windows verträgt sich nun mal
am 07.04.2016 - 09:53 Uhr
Windows verträgt sich nun mal nicht so gut mit einer Unix Umgebung. Ich habe bereits verschiedentlich vergeblich versucht Xamp auf Windows zum laufen zu bekommen und aufgegeben. Da gibt es mir je nach Windows-Version zu viele Haken und Ösen. Ich empfehle für Windows mittels der Virtual Box einen virtuellen Unix-Server auf der Windows System aufzusetzen. Die genaue Vorgehensweise findest Du im Handbuch im Drupalcenter. Dann hast Du eine Unix-Umgebung und alles verhält sich "normal".
Hallo,Der PHP kann die Datei
am 07.04.2016 - 10:05 Uhr
Hallo,
PHP kann die Datei nicht finden:
Fatal error: require_once(): Failed opening required 'C:\xampp\htdocs\Drupal/sites/all/modules/mimemail/includes/mimemail.mail.inc'
Schau mal nach, ob diese Datei dort ist C:\xampp\htdocs\Drupal/sites\all\modules\mimemail\includes\mimemail.mail.inc
Das mit den Slashes ist eigentlich egal, PHP kommt mit beiden zurecht.
Gruss
Robert
Unix in VirtualBox
am 07.04.2016 - 14:27 Uhr
Hallo Werner,
nun habe ich nach Anleitung die Unix Umgebung installiert und kann auch auf Drupal zugreifen und mich als Admin einloggen.
Ich habe mit Linux noch nie was zu tun gehabt und ich muß sagen ich weiß jetzt nicht wie ich meine Dateien da hin kopiert bekomme.
Einen FTP Server scheint es in dieser Debian Umgebung nicht zu geben. Und beim Versuch den ProFTPD zu installieren bin ich auch gescheitert.
Laut google ist das in Debian schon dabei und muß nur installiert und configuriert werden, doch leider scheint das in dieser Version nicht zu sein.
Da ich auch nicht weiß wie ich denn nun den Installer runtergelden bekomme geschweige installiert, steh ich ganz schön auf dem Schlauch.
Die Datenbank habe ich problemlos importieren können. :-))
Eventuell hast du ja noch einen Tip für mich wie ich jetzt meine Drupal Dateien nach Debian bekomme.
Sorry für null Plan von Linux. ;-(
Gruß Udo
Du hast Post
am 07.04.2016 - 18:35 Uhr
Du hast Post